WebMay 21, 2024 · Flow Accelerated Corrosion(FAC)? 3 FAC is a chemical corrosion process that causes wall losing in pipe. Caused by the dissolution of oxide layer on the inside surface of piping in flowing water or wetsteam. Affects carbon or low carbon steel. Pipe wall thickness progressively reduceto point of rupture.
